Taxi fares in Kansas generally include a base fare, a per-mile rate, and additional charges for waiting time, luggage, and airport pickups. Here’s a typical breakdown:
For example, a 12-mile trip in Wichita might cost: $4.00 (base fare) + (12 miles x $2.25) = $31.00, excluding any extra charges.
Below are estimated taxi fares between major Kansas cities and their airports:
Kansas is known for its long highways and varied traffic patterns, especially around larger cities like Wichita and Topeka. With a taxi fare tool, you can calculate an estimated price before booking a taxi, ensuring you aren’t overpaying, especially during peak traffic hours.
For airport transfers in Kansas, whether you’re traveling to Wichita Dwight D. Eisenhower or Kansas City International Airport, using a fare tool is essential. Many taxi services offer fixed fare options for these trips, helping you lock in a predictable rate regardless of traffic or time of day.
| Route | Day Fare | Night Fare | Drivers Available |
|---|---|---|---|
| Wichita to Wichita Dwight D. Eisenhower National Airport (ICT) | $20 - $30 | $30 - $35 | 200 |
| Topeka to Kansas City International Airport (MCI) | $80 - $90 | $90 - $100 | 150 |
| Lawrence to Kansas City International Airport (MCI) | $60 - $70 | $70 - $80 | 120 |
| Manhattan to Manhattan Regional Airport (MHK) | $18 - $24 | $24 - $28 | 80 |
| Overland Park to Kansas City International Airport (MCI) | $50 - $60 | $60 - $65 | 100 |
